SALVATION ARMY MCKEESPORT CORPS HOSTS ANNUAL VOLUNTEER DINNER

The Salvation Army McKeesport Corps hosted its annual Volunteer Appreciation Dinner on Feb. 23 — thanking local churches, community groups and individual volunteers for their assistance. Captains Moner and Sarah Lapaix thanked volunteers for helping to share their mission to embrace and empower the McKeesport community through service projects, youth programming, and outreach.
